Boss TV founders Rong Urquico and Lyle Howry are hosting a celebrity charity event to benefit Give Kids The World Village (GKTW) on March 31st at the Beverly Hills Country Club. The event will raise funds and awareness for GKTW, a 70-acre, nonprofit âstorybookâ Village located near Central Floridaâs most beloved attractions. Here, children with life-threatening illnesses and families are treated to weeklong, cost-free fantasy vacations complete with accommodations in whimsical villas, donated attractions tickets, entertainment, meals and much more. Since 1986, GKTW has provided the happiness that inspires hope fo r more than 115,000 families from all 50 states and more than 70 countries.
